When a C atom is attached to 2 groups and so is involved in 2 s bonds, it requires 2 orbitals in the hybrid set. This requires that it is sp hybridised. The general "steps" are similar to that for seen previously sp3 and sp2 hybridization.

The phenomenon of mixing up of different orbitals of same energy level of an atom to produce equal number of hybrid-orbitals of same energy and identical properties is known as hybridization. A hybrid orbital contains maximum two electrons with opposite spin.

The process of hybridization in which one s-orbital and one p-orbital overlap to produce two hybrid orbital is known as Sp- HYBRIDIZATION. This type of hybridization is also called diagonal hybridization. These orbital are at an angle of 180o.

This involves the mixing of one s- and one p-orbital forming two sp-hybrid orbitals. The two sp-hybrid orbitals are oriented in a linear arrangement and bond angle is 180°. For e.g., BeF2 involves sp-hybridization and is, therefore, linear.
